Bug Description

kubuntu - gutsy - kde4 - nvidia card - gigabyte motherboard - pentium 4 2.8ghz

kde4 displays multiple screens within the one screen. It is displaying the taskbar roughly a 3rd of the way up the screen. There is no way to lower taskbar to appropriate bottom of screen.

It seems to be running multiple screens at the wrong resolution. My xorg.conf is set in KDe3 to display 2 desktops my 1440x900 LCD screen and my second screen ( My TV ). However it may be causing issue in KDE4.

It is hard to describe in words so have attached screenshot and my xorg.conf.
